Understanding the Components
Before diving into the assembly process, it’s crucial to familiarize yourself with the key components that make up a vape mod:
- Battery: The power source for your mod. Lithium-ion batteries are the most common choice due to their high energy density and rechargeability.
- Chipset: The brain of the mod, controlling functions like wattage, temperature, and safety features. Popular chipsets include DNA and Yeehee.
- Enclosure: The casing of your mod, which houses the battery and chipset. This can be made from various materials like aluminum, stainless steel, or plastic.
- Wiring: Essential for connecting different components and ensuring the safe operation of the mod.
Gathering Tools and Materials
Building a vape mod requires specific tools and materials. Ensure you have the following:
- Wire cutters and strippers
- Soldering iron and solder
- Multimeter for testing
- Heat shrink tubing
- Insulation tape
- Battery and chipset of your choice
- Enclosure
Assembling Your Vape Mod
Now that you have your components and tools ready, it’s time to start assembling:
- Install the Chipset: Start by securely mounting the chipset into the enclosure. Make sure it fits snugly and is firmly attached.
- Connect the Battery: Identify the positive and negative terminals of your battery. Connect these to the appropriate points on your chipset, ensuring a secure and correct polarity.
- Soldering: Use your soldering iron to make connections between the chipset, battery, and any additional components. Be cautious and ensure that there are no short circuits.
- Wiring: Organize your wires neatly within the enclosure. Use heat shrink tubing where necessary to prevent any accidental connections.
- Final Checks: Before sealing the mod, use a multimeter to test the connections and ensure everything is functioning correctly. Check for any potential short circuits or issues.
